Transaction 3d9838ea1d3da2dcd758045a68f8a4a112d40341cd8f785dfd93ac298e6cc2f4
1 Input
1 Output
-
3d9838ea1d3da2dcd758045a68f8a4a112d40341cd8f785dfd93ac298e6cc2f4:0
- value
- 1510950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c80af777b97f1edf53dd8b658183f0b705dd641 OP_EQUAL
- address
- 3FxXVguS1w1KhcKYdsXS56xqniHxrB5ztN